Salesforce AI Agents Assist Military Families with Relocation and Housing Navigation

Salesforce has introduced AI agents designed to support military families facing the unique challenges of frequent relocations and housing transitions. The technology addresses a significant pain point for service members and their dependents, who often navigate complex moving procedures and housing searches while managing military assignments.

The AI agents leverage Salesforce's platform to provide personalized guidance throughout the relocation process. By automating routine inquiries and offering tailored recommendations, the solution aims to reduce administrative burden and improve the overall moving experience for military households.

Key capabilities include helping families identify appropriate housing options near military installations, understanding local market conditions, and managing logistics associated with permanent change of station (PCS) moves. The agents can process information about military benefits, housing allowances, and community resources to provide comprehensive support.

This initiative reflects growing recognition of the challenges military families face during transitions. Frequent moves can disrupt employment, education, and social stability, making streamlined relocation support increasingly valuable. By deploying AI technology, Salesforce aims to make the process more efficient and less stressful.

The solution integrates with existing military family support systems and can be customized to address specific regional housing markets and military installation requirements. This approach demonstrates how enterprise technology platforms are expanding beyond traditional business applications to serve specialized communities with distinct needs.

For military families, the availability of AI-powered assistance represents a meaningful step toward modernizing support systems that have traditionally relied on manual processes and fragmented resources. As military relocation patterns continue, such technological solutions could become increasingly important for retention and family welfare initiatives across the Department of Defense.
